Understanding the Cisco Vedge 2000 Throughput Datasheet

The Cisco Vedge 2000 Throughput Datasheet is essentially a technical specification document that outlines the performance capabilities of the Cisco Vedge 2000, specifically focusing on its data processing and forwarding rates, often referred to as throughput. This isn't just a random number; it represents how much data the Vedge 2000 can handle within a given period, measured in bits per second (bps) or packets per second (pps). This metric is critical because a network device's throughput directly impacts the speed and responsiveness of your network. If a device cannot handle the required data volume, users will experience slow connections, dropped packets, and a generally poor network experience.

These datasheets are used in several key ways. Firstly, for capacity planning . Before deploying a Vedge 2000, organizations consult the datasheet to ensure it can meet their current and projected network traffic demands. This prevents over-provisioning (wasting money on unnecessary capacity) or under-provisioning (leading to performance bottlenecks). Secondly, for performance validation . After deployment, the datasheet serves as a benchmark against which actual network performance can be measured. If real-world throughput falls short of datasheet specifications, it signals a potential issue that needs investigation. Finally, for feature comparison . When choosing between different network devices or configurations, the throughput figures provided in the datasheet are vital for comparing their capabilities.

Understanding these specific scenarios is important. For instance, the maximum forwarding rate indicates the raw packet-handling capacity. However, when Virtual Network Functions (VNFs) are running, the throughput can be affected by the processing power required for those functions. The datasheet will often detail throughput with specific VNFs enabled, allowing for a more realistic assessment of performance in a virtualized environment. This detailed breakdown ensures that users have a comprehensive understanding of the Vedge 2000's capabilities under different operating conditions.
